The design is made with two different colors of wool. Basically what must be achieved is to weave a kind of rhombus in each of the two colors. To do this, the first row is knitted with the starting color, which we will call the primary color. The second round with the secondary color and from the third round onwards, the corners are knitted with one color and the sides with the other color.
To achieve this we must carry the secondary thread inside, as is done in the Tapestry crochet technique.
It is necessary to be very patient, since when weaving with one of the threads inside, the threads tend to tangle. Then we must weave and untangle the two strands of the balls.

I find this granny pattern ideal for making blankets, because the more twists the granny has, the better the diamond or diamond design looks. It is also important to use contrasting colors to make the effect look nicer.
